[:en]SCRIPTURE:  1 CORINTHIANS 16 

“Be on guard, stand firm in the faith; be men of courage; be stong.  Do everything in love” (1 Corinthians 16:14)

THE COLLECTION FOR GOD’S PEOPLE (vs. 1-4)

Paul reminded the believers in Corinth concerning the offering for the needy Jewish in Judea.  A church member must bring his tithes and offerings to the church.  There must be church appointed representatives to handle the collection for proper accounting.

PERSONAL REQUESTS (vs. 5-24)

  1. Accept Timothy and assist him. (vs. 10-11)
  2. I’m convincing Apollos to go to you if he has the opportunity (v. 12)
  3. Be on guard, stand firm in faith; be men of courage, be strong. (v. 13)
  4. Do everything in love (v. 14)
  5. Submit to everyone who labors in the service of the Lord (v. 16)
  6. Recognize Stephanas, Fortunatus and Achaicus for their generosity. (v. 17)

FINAL GREETINGS (vs. 19-24)

Paul mentioned his beloved Aquila and Priscilla for their assistance.  He never forget to acknowledge his indebtedness to them.  He closed with the greetings: “My love to all of you in Christ Jesus” (v. 24)

SUMMARY:

Paul instructed all believers to be faithful to the church by their offerings to the Lord regularly.  Giving is for everyone -rich and poor – in proportionate to his income.  The church must have a sound financial system with proper records of receipts and disbursement.

Paul encouraged the saints to support, appreciate and treat their Christian workers well.  Pastors must have good relationship with one another.  We must acknowledge those who have assisted us.  All brothers in Christ must be united with love by the grace of God.[:]
